[n] the quantity contained in a pail Synonyms | Synonyms for Pail: bucket | pailful Related Terms | Find terms related to Pail: See Also | cannikin | containerful | dinner bucket | dinner pail | dredging bucket | kibble | slop jar | slop pail | vessel | water wheel | waterwheel | wine bucket | wine cooler Pail In Webster's Dictionary \Pail\, n. [OE. paile, AS. p[ae]gel a wine vessel, a pail,
akin to D. & G. pegel a watermark, a gauge rod, a measure of
wine, Dan. p[ae]gel half a pint.]
A vessel of wood or tin, etc., usually cylindrical and having
a bail, -- used esp. for carrying liquids, as water or milk,
etc.; a bucket. It may, or may not, have a cover. --Shak.
